Your valve adjustment and what he is referring to are two different balls of wax. I'm assuming this is a hydraulic cam? Adjust the valve with the set screw loose, snug up the set screw, and then give the nut a hair more with a 9/16 wrench. If you are using a big ratchet or a super long wrench, you could over tighten the poly locks and crack them just as he said.
